What Exactly is a Source Code Synopsis?
Alright, let's get down to the basics. A source code synopsis is essentially a concise summary of a program's structure, functionality, and purpose. It's like the CliffNotes for your code. Instead of sifting through thousands of lines, a synopsis provides a high-level overview, highlighting the key components, their relationships, and what the program is designed to do. It's your go-to resource for understanding the big picture before you delve into the nitty-gritty details.
Imagine you're reading a novel. You wouldn't start by analyzing every single sentence, right? Instead, you'd likely read the synopsis first to get a feel for the plot, characters, and overall theme. A source code synopsis does the same thing for your code. It gives you context, enabling you to grasp the program's essence without getting bogged down in the technicalities.
The beauty of a well-crafted synopsis lies in its ability to save you time and effort. It's a shortcut to understanding complex codebases, especially when dealing with large projects or code you're unfamiliar with. It also serves as a valuable tool for collaboration, allowing developers to quickly grasp each other's work and contribute effectively. Think of it as a shared language that facilitates communication and reduces the chances of misinterpretations. A good synopsis will typically include the following elements: program purpose, modules and their relationships, key functions and their roles, data structures, and overall control flow.

Crafting Your Own Source Code Synopsis: A Step-by-Step Guide
Ready to create your own source code synopsis? Awesome! Here's a step-by-step guide to get you started, making it as painless as possible, guys. First things first, read the code! Before you start writing, take some time to familiarize yourself with the codebase. Try to understand the program's purpose, the different modules, and how they interact.
Next, identify the key components. Pinpoint the essential modules, classes, functions, and data structures that are critical to the program's operation. Focus on the parts that drive the core functionality. Then, describe the purpose of each component. Briefly explain what each module, class, or function is designed to do. This will help the reader quickly understand the code's structure. Describe the flow of data and execution. Detail how the program starts, the order in which different parts of the code are executed, and how the data is processed.
After this, illustrate the relationships between components. Use diagrams or visualizations to show how different modules, classes, and functions connect and interact with each other. This provides a visual representation of the program's architecture. Now you can highlight the key algorithms and data structures. Explain the critical algorithms and data structures used in the program. This provides insights into the program's efficiency and design. Then, write a concise summary of the program's functionality. Describe what the program does in a few sentences, summarizing the core tasks it performs. Then, keep it updated. As the code evolves, remember to update the synopsis to reflect the changes. This will ensure that the documentation remains accurate and useful.

Documentation Generators
Automated documentation generators can save you a ton of time and effort. These tools automatically parse your code and generate documentation, including synopses, based on the comments and annotations you've added. Some popular options include: JSDoc (for JavaScript), Javadoc (for Java), and Doxygen (for C, C++, and Python). These generators can create well-formatted documentation in various formats, such as HTML or PDF, making it easy to share and access. These are great time-savers.
Code Analysis Tools
Code analysis tools can help you understand the structure and complexity of your code. These tools analyze your code and generate reports that highlight potential issues, such as code smells, bugs, and security vulnerabilities. They also provide information about the dependencies between different parts of your code, which can be helpful for creating a synopsis. Some of the most common tools are SonarQube and PMD, just to name a couple. These are your code's best friends!

Visualization Tools
Visualization tools can help you create diagrams and charts that illustrate the structure and relationships within your code. These visualizations can be a powerful way to communicate complex information and make your synopsis more engaging. Some popular options include PlantUML and Graphviz. These can help communicate the complex relationships in an easy-to-understand format.
Best Practices for an Awesome Synopsis
To make your source code synopsis truly shine, here are some best practices to keep in mind:
- Be Concise: Keep it brief and to the point. Focus on the essential information and avoid unnecessary details. Brevity is key!
- Be Accurate: Ensure that the synopsis accurately reflects the code. Double-check your information and update it whenever the code changes.
- Be Clear: Use clear and simple language. Avoid jargon and technical terms that might confuse readers. Write for your audience.
- Be Consistent: Use a consistent format and style throughout your synopsis. This will make it easier to read and understand.
- Be Updated: Keep your synopsis up-to-date with the latest changes to the code. This will ensure that it remains relevant and useful.
- Use Diagrams: Incorporate diagrams, flowcharts, or other visual aids to illustrate the program's structure and flow.
- Provide Examples: Include code snippets or examples to illustrate key concepts or functionalities.
- Target the Audience: Consider the audience for your synopsis. Tailor the level of detail and technical language to suit their needs.
